#046.5 - Paras spend a lot of time burrowing underground to gnaw on tree roots. When they hatch, they are doused with the mushroom spores that cover their egg, and as they grow mushrooms begin to sprout from their back. By the time the tochukaso mushrooms have begun to fruit, they have merged with the Pokemon’s nervous system and steal away most of the nutrients Paras consume. As Paras continue to mature, Trainers often report these Pokemon acting strangely.
